The artwork plays with geometry and light to create a sense of depth and attraction, drawing the viewer into its luminous embrace and offering a fresh perspective of the capital’s architecture and spirit. *** About Ottawa ***: Ottawa, the capital city of Canada, is known for its stately government buildings, including the iconic Parliament Hill. It is a place rich in history and culture, boasting museums, parks, and yearly festivals like the Canadian Tulip Festival and Winterlude. The city seamlessly melds English and French Canadian cultures, offering a bilingual atmosphere. Home to official national museums, Ottawa serves as a repository of Canadian heritage and traditions, making it a critical center for understanding Canada's national narrative.
